Upper White Lakes Draw
Upper White Lakes Draw is a valley in Apache, Arizona and has an elevation of 6,243 feet.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Valley with an elevation of 6,243 feet
- Also known as: “White Lakes Draw”
- Category: landform
- Location: Apache, Arizona, Southwest, United States, North America
